Andhra Pradesh Energy Minister Directs Officials to Develop Six-Month Plan for Power Sector Operations

Andhra Pradesh Energy Minister Gottipati Ravi Kumar has instructed officials to devise a comprehensive strategy for the power sector's seamless operation over the next six months. During a detailed review of the state's power utilities, he emphasised the government's dedication to ensuring an uninterrupted power supply across all sectors. This commitment includes increasing renewable energy production, particularly solar and wind, to meet the growing demand, especially during the summer months.

Six-Month Plan for Andhra Power Sector

According to projections, peak power demand in Andhra Pradesh could reach 13,700 MW, with daily electricity consumption expected to be around 260 million units during the summer. The state is implementing projects worth Rs 15,508 crore under the Revamped Distribution Sector Scheme (RDSS). These projects focus on smart metering, infrastructure development, and augmentation to enhance distribution efficiency and reduce losses.

Focus on Renewable Energy and Infrastructure

The state is prioritising modernising substations and upgrading transmission networks. Advanced metering solutions are being deployed to improve service quality and reliability. Kumar highlighted that these initiatives aim to ensure a consistent electricity supply throughout Andhra Pradesh. The transition of agricultural power supply to solar mode is also underway as part of sustainable energy goals.

Plans are in place to solarise approximately 1,200 agricultural feeders with a solar capacity of around 1600 MW. This initiative will provide daytime free power to nearly three lakh agricultural consumers. The move aims to achieve both environmental sustainability and cost-effectiveness. Kumar reiterated the government's unwavering commitment to enhancing the state's power infrastructure.
